The UK is set to see the return of a scorching heatwave soon, with temperatures to soar once again from next month. Preliminary data from forecasters at the Met Office show that June has been the hottest month in the UK ever, with more warm weather to come, reports the Mirror.
There have been long spells of scorching temperatures and clear skies throughout the month, reaching into the 30Cs in Scotland in June.However, typical British weather returned and heavy showers hit, with more storms to come this week alongside milder temperatures.However, with July just around the corner, forecasters are predicting yet another heatwave for the UK.
This new heatwave is predicted to even beat 2022's record-breaking temperature in Lincolnshire of 40.3C. In Scotland, the hottest ever temperature was 34.8C recorded in the Borders in 2022.
Scotland recorded its hottest day of 2023 in June in Dumfries and Galloway, which reached 30.7C.The Met Office said indications for "above-average temperatures are stronger" from July 12 to July 26.
